Job description
Engineering Estimator

Salary: Negotiable depending on experience

Location: Northampton

Type: Permanent, Full-Time

Are you a skilled machinist or engineer ready to move off the shop floor and into a technical commercial role? If so, we may have the perfect opportunity for you….

This is an exciting opportunity to join a fast-growing engineering business, that provides safety complex manufacturing solutions to highly regulated industries. The successful applicant will be supporting the delivery of high-quality components to elite performance customers.

Due to business growth, our client is now seeking an Engineering Estimator to work closely with the General Manager. This position involves technically evaluating customer requirements, developing manufacturing processes, and ensuring the accuracy and competitiveness of quotations.

What’s in it for you?
  • Competitive salary: Negotiable depending on experience
  • Work-Life Balance: Early finish every Friday
  • Generous Benefits: 25 days holiday + bank holidays, pension scheme, overtime paid at enhanced rates
  • Career Growth: Full training, development, and clear progression pathways
  • Job Security: Permanent position with long-term stability in a growing business
What you’ll be doing:
  • Reviewing and interpreting engineering drawings, highlighting any potential challenges
  • Creating accurate manufacturing routes within our ERP system, including material and cycle time costings
  • Working collaboratively with production engineering and operations to ensure capacity and process alignment
  • Supporting continuous improvement of estimating tools and data
  • Ensuring a smooth handover from quote to production for successful project delivery
What we’re looking for:
  • Strong background performing CNC Machining duties - (setting, operating and editing) multi‑axis Milling & Turning machines, ideally looking to step into an office‑based role
  • CNC Programming experience would be preferable
  • Strong understanding of tooling, speeds, and feeds across various materials
  • Confident reading complex drawings with solid GD&T knowledge
  • Excellent computer skills and willingness to learn new systems
  • A proactive mindset and enthusiasm for developing new commercial skills
